Employment Statistics
353 residents are over the age of 16 and 204 people are in labor force. Among them, 204 people are in civilian labor force and 0 are in armed labor force. 202 people are employed and the unemployment rate is 1.00%.

Average Income and Health Insurance
The average household income is $84,245 for the 175 households in Loop Independent School District area, Texas. The average income of a single worker is $39,679. 527 people have a health insurance and the health insurance coverage rate is 91.97%.
Housing
There are 220 housing units in Loop Independent School District area, Texas with 175 units (79.55%) occupied. 117 houses (66.86%) are occupied by owner and 58 houses (33.14%) are rented. The average housing value is $86,300 and the average rental cost is $428. 0 houses (0.00%) were newly built in 2014 or later and 16 houses (7.27%) were built in 1949 or earlier.
